The Thought: Last night Terry and I were sitting outside on the swing about 8:30 p.m.  That is when the symphony of frogs begins each night and Paddy the dog begins to freak out.  


I noticed last night that the Old Bull Frog starts the evening out with a few low croaks.  Then the older frogs all begin their part in the music. This lasts about five minutes and they get totally quiet and the tiny frogs begin their chirping.  This continues in repetition for the entire night.  After those baby frogs sing... total silence. Then Old Bull Frog croaks three times and immediately the old frogs begin to sing...and lastly the tiny frogs.


Such magnificence is from the Almighty and only He is the creator of this chorus.  The same is true with the early morning bird that sings his song about 5:30-6:00 as the sun is rising in the east.  After 6:00 am... he stops singing and then we begin to hear the other birds as they wake. 
Every thing seems to be in patterns, Holy Patterns from God.


Every song is at the appointed time, no sooner and no later.  If God can lead this symphony, He can definitely conduct the symphony for our lives.
